Danitra Brown

Danitra Brown is the self-possessed title character in Nikki Grimes's three children's poetry books about her friendship with Zuri Jackson.

Danitra Brown is the title character in Nikki Grimes’s connected poetry books about two best friends. Zuri Jackson usually tells the story, describing Danitra’s confidence, imagination, and place in their friendship.

The series begins with Meet Danitra Brown, then follows the girls through a summer separation and school life. Grimes has said that the first book’s small stories drew on her childhood and found their form as a suite of poems.

Read the three books in publication order. They work well for readers who want a short, verse-based story of a friendship growing through ordinary childhood events.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who is Danitra Brown's best friend?

Danitra Brown’s best friend is Zuri Jackson. The poems in the series are told from Zuri’s perspective, celebrating her friendship with the bold and imaginative Danitra.

How many Danitra Brown books are there?

There are three books in the Danitra Brown series: Meet Danitra Brown (1984), Danitra Brown Leaves Town (2001), and Danitra Brown, Class Clown (2005).

How are the Danitra Brown stories told?

The stories are told in connected poems, usually from Zuri Jackson’s point of view. The books follow the girls through everyday experiences, friendship, and change.
